AWS Group incorrect behavior - is always above other items Hi,This is rather a bug report, not a question.I’m a pretty experienced miro user (like 5 years of every-week, professional use).Recently I started drawing AWS diagrams, using AWS templates. I noticed that “AWS Group” object behaves incorrectly. E.g. totally different from a frame or standard rectangle.Bring back doesn’t work, neither by a shortcut nor by context menu. Its edges are above normal connection lines. If I however, bring such a covered line into front, then it’s correct, but apparently after continuing the work, the AWS group gets back to front by itself. Cannot click some objects that are inside the group. E.g., I have a small circle from standard shapes inside the group, but It’s hard to click it (select / gaining focus, you name it).
